Ajouter au panierCloth. Etat : Very Good. Mary Ward (illustrateur). First edition. The scarce first edition of pioneering Victorian scientist Mary Ward's introduction to microscopy. Illustrated with hand coloured plates. The scarce first edition of this work. This informative volume evolved from the author's first work, 'Sketches with the Microscope' (1857), of which only two-hundred and fifty copies were produced.Mary Ward was an important scientist for her pioneering work in microscopy and entomology, contributing significantly to the understanding of microscopic organisms and insects in the 19th century. She is the earliest known victim of a car accident, when she was mown down by an experimental steam car built by her cousins.Illustrated with sixteen hand coloured plates after sketches from the author. Ajouter au panierFirst edition of this celebrated introduction to microscopy by one of the foremost popularizers of Victorian science. A substantially expanded version of Ward's 1858 work, A World of Wonders Revealed by the Microscope, it is copiously illustrated with colour plates and engravings based on her own meticulous artwork. Gifted a microscope by her father when she was 18, Ward (1827-1869) "took a keen interest in natural history and astronomy from childhood. Her enthusiasm led to serious study and she produced microscope slides and skilled and accurate illustrations, both for her own work and for others. Ward put on exhibitions for her family and friends and hand-printed her own booklets" (Matthews). Microscope Teachings evolved from her first book, Sketches with the Microscope (1857), which was published locally in 250 copies in her native Ireland. After its favourable reception, the London publishers Groombridge and Sons republished it as A World of Wonders Revealed by the Microscope (1858). From here, the text of Ward's best-seller split in two and significantly increased in length to become the uniformly bound pairing of Telescope Teachings (1859) and this title. Ward "takes her place among the popularizers of science who, during the eighteenth and nineteenth centuries, did much to encourage a knowledge of, and interest in, the natural world among the general public, and thus to stimulate the advances in science and technology that marked the industrial revolution" (ODNB). At the request of Sir William Rowan Hamilton, she was one of three women given special dispensation to receive the Royal Astronomical Society's Monthly Notices, the others on the mailing list being Mary Somerville and Queen Victoria. Ward died aged 42 after being thrown from a steam-powered automobile invented by the sons of her cousin William Parsons, third Earl of Rosse. Parsons keenly encouraged Ward's interest in microscopy; she was 17 when he built the telescope known as the "Leviathan of Parsonstown" at Birr Castle, which remained the world's largest telescope (in terms of aperture size) until the early 20th century.
